Best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ering Schools in Virginia

Virginia has 2 colleges offering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ering programs tracked by the College Scorecard, producing 126 recent graduates. Graduates in Virginia earn $69,803 on average within two years — 8% above the national average of $64,837, making the state one of the stronger markets for this field.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best school for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ering in Virginia?
University of Virginia-Main Campus ranks #1 for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ering in Virginia with median graduate earnings of $74,576 within two years of graduation. There are 2 schools offering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ering programs in the state.
How much do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ering graduates earn in Virginia?
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ering graduates in Virginia earn an average of $69,803 within two years of graduation. This is 8% above the national average of $64,837 for this major.
What is the hardest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ering school to get into in Virginia?
University of Virginia-Main Campus is the most selective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ering program in Virginia with an acceptance rate of 16.9%. The average acceptance rate across Aerospace, Aeronautical and Astronautical Engineering programs in the state is 36.9%.
